Source: node-async
Version: 0.8.0-1
Severity: important

Dear Maintainer,

on my installation I find async.js (and package.json) to be installed under
/usr/lib/nodejs/async.js and /usr/lib/nodejs/package.json. If a nother package
uses the same path, it would overwrite/conflict with package.json. I thus
recommend to put these files into their own subdirectory. Ideally it would even
be renamed to index.js, so that it would read /usr/lib/nodejs/async/index.js
but that probably creates more problems then it solves with regards to
backwards compatibility.
